OverviewSenior Electrical EngineerWestwood Professional
Services, Inc. is seeking a Senior Electrical Engineer to join our
renewables team. The position is responsible for managing the
electrical engineering of commercial and utility-scale solar
projects. The Senior Electrical Engineer will be the primary
electrical contact for clients and will oversee the electrical
design budget for projects to ensure budgets are met. This position
is open in Minneapolis, Denver, Plano, Madison, and
Charlotte.Duties and Responsibilities
- Manage the electrical engineering of commercial and
utility-scale solar projects, ensuring adherence to project
budgets.
- Verify the incorporation of contractual electrical engineering
scope into design and coordinate change orders with project
managers.
- Ensure project deliverable schedules for electrical engineering
scope are met.
- Assist project managers in responding to RFPs by preparing
proposal scope and fees for the electrical engineering.
- Coordinate with other project disciplines, including civil
engineers, geotechnical/structural engineers, and surveyors.
- Schedule and plan necessary resources needed to support
projects on a weekly basis.
- Perform and lead electrical engineering design and creation of
construction documents for projects.
- Oversee project electrical team resources and be responsible
for staff performing electrical calculations and studies.
- Coordinate with clients, utilities, and code enforcement
officers.
- Perform QA/QC of design work performed on projects for which
you are the lead electrical engineer.
- Maintain awareness of currently available equipment and
industry best practices.
- Collaborate with and support electrical engineering teams in
other offices as projects and workload sharing between offices
dictates.
- Support construction of projects by responding to contractor
and owner requests, including RFIs and submittal review.
- Assist Market Directors as needed for marketing efforts and
creation of marketing materials surrounding electrical engineering
work.
- Supervise, train, and mentor graduate engineers, staff
engineers, and design technicians.Required Experience
-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ering or Renewable
Engineering Program.
- Knowledge of NEC and NESC.
- Knowledge and proficiency in the use of an electrical power
system modeling program(s).
- 6-10 years of experience in the design of electrical
distribution, generation, and/or general electrical
construction.
- Working knowledge and ability to read and create construction
drawings and specifications.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office products.
- Professional appearance with excellent written and verbal
communication skills.
- Experience with writing proposals, managing project budgets,
invoices and change order processes, progress reports, managing
project data, and communicating project requirements to clients and
internal stakeholders.
- Strong work ethic and positive attitude.
- Ability to work in a collaborative environment and be a
supportive team member.
- Self-motivated with the ability to balance multiple projects
under tight deadlines without supervision.
- Limited capacity experience with AutoCAD.
- Experience and knowledge of overall design and construction of
utility-scale PV and/or wind plants.Preferred Experience
- NABCEP Certification.
- Proficiency in AutoCAD Civil 3D.
- Electrical PE License or ability to be licensed in multiple
states.
- Experience with energy storage systems (battery, flywheel, or
capacitor).
- Proficiency with ETAP, CYMCAP, WinIGS, and/or DigSilent
PowerFactory to model electrical power systems and perform load
flow, short circuit, voltage drop, grounding, thermal, and
protective device coordination studies and analysis.
- Experience with PVsyst, Helioscope, SAM, or other PV production
modeling software.
- Experience with Helios 3D, PVcase, RatedPower, SolarFarmer, or
other PV site layout software.
- Experience with PSS/E, PSCAD, EMTP, or similar software and
performing transient/dynamic modeling and studies of power
systems.Compensation RangeMinimum: USD $120,000.00/Yr.Maximum: USD
